Excerpt from The Orations of Demosthenes on the Crown and on the Embassy, Vol. 2 of 2

The fears of the people were not realized. Philip, while he 'chastised the Theban s, treated the Athenians with moderation and clemency; restoring their prisoners without ransom, burying their dead upon the field, and sending their bones to Athens. He deprived them indeed of most of their foreign possessions, but even enlarged their domestic territory b the addition of Oropus.
